第11周 项目1 函数版星号图 (2)(3)

来源:互联网 发布:mac 大写灯不亮 编辑:程序博客网 时间:2024/06/16 22:32
/*  * Copyright (c) 2014, 烟台大学计算机学院  * All rights reserved.  * 文件名称:test.cpp  * 作    者:呼亚萍   * 完成日期:2014年 11 月 8 日  * 版 本 号:v1.0  *  * 问题描述:输出函数版星号图 * 输入描述:相应的程序 * 程序输出:函数版星号图  */#include <iostream>using namespace std;void printchs(int m , char ch){    for(int j=1; j<=m; ++j)    {        cout<<ch;    }}int main( ){    int n=6;    int i;    for(i=1; i<=n; ++i)    {        printchs(n-i,' ');        printchs(2*i-1,'*') ;        cout<<endl;    }    return 0;}


运算结果:

/*  * Copyright (c) 2014, 烟台大学计算机学院  * All rights reserved.  * 文件名称:test.cpp  * 作    者:呼亚萍   * 完成日期:2014年 11 月 8 日  * 版 本 号:v1.0  *  * 问题描述:输出函数版星号图 * 输入描述:相应的程序 * 程序输出:函数版星号图  */#include <iostream>using namespace std;void printchs(int m , char ch){    for(int j=1; j<=m; ++j)    {        cout<<ch;    }}int main( ){    int n=7;    int i;    for(i=1; i<=n; ++i)    {        printchs(n-i,' ');        printchs(2*i-1,'A'+i-1) ;        cout<<endl;    }    return 0;}


运算结果:

知识点总结:

调用函数的使用,for语句的使用

学习心得:

要不断的练习,才能更加熟练,加油!

0 0